DEBRA WINANS SATISFIED WITH OPRAH'S BEBE BAN: 'She's willing to take the steps necessary to defend the defenseless,' said singer's ex-wife.(November 9, 2009)
*The ex-wife of gospel singer BeBe Winans says she's pleased with the decision of Oprah Winfrey to remove him from her "Karaoke Challenge" until his domestic violence case is resolved.
Debra Winans made headlines last week when she questioned Winfrey's stance against domestic violence in light of her ex-husband's continued appearances on her talk show despite his domestic abuse case. In February, BeBe was arrested for allegedly shoving Debra to the pavement outside of her home. He is due back in court on Jan. 20. Earlier in the year, Winfrey devoted an entire hour to domestic violence after Rihanna was beaten by Chris Brown. In response to Winfrey's decision late last week to drop BeBe, Debra gave the following statement to TMZ.com: "It further demonstrates the fact that Oprah continues to be a strong voice against domestic violence and that she's willing to take the steps necessary to defend the defenseless."
